3. RBI notifies guidelines for early detection and recovery of bad loans.

    RBI notifies NBFCs and other financial institutions to categorize loans into special mention accounts  before a loan turns into NPA
   (A) . SMA 0 :A/C overdue not more than 30 days but facing stress.
   (B) SMA 1:  principal/interest overdue between 31-60 days.
   (c)  SMA 2 : Principal/interest overdue for 61-180 days
However NPA should be held by concerned banks for a period of 12 months before selling it to other financial institution or NBFC.

5. RBI issued notice to banks concerning discontinuation of Windows XP.

 

  Reserve Bank of India raised concern over the threat expected to face from discontinuation of windows XP by Microsoft corporation from 8th April,Withdrawal will stop release of updates and patches for the OS, which will make it more vulnerable to virus attacks.In India most of the banking system are running on windows XP.
